发布时间:2024-11-05 17:25:08
在当今快速发展的科技领域,编程语言是最核心的工具之一。而在众多编程语言中,Golang(Go)因其出色的性能和简洁的语法而备受开发者青睐。那么,作为一个专业的Golang开发者,我坚信Golang是值得投资的。
首先,Golang在并发处理方面表现出色。Goroutine是Golang中的轻量级线程,可以实现高效的并行执行。与传统的线程相比,Goroutine的启动时间极快,而且资源消耗也较低。此外,Golang提供了内置的Channel用于Goroutine之间的通信,能够有效地避免竞态条件和死锁等问题。这使得开发者能够轻松地编写出高效并发的程序,提升了系统的整体性能。
其次,Golang拥有强大而丰富的标准库。标准库包含了各种常用的功能模块,如网络编程、文件操作、加密解密等等,而且这些模块都被精心设计和优化,使用起来非常方便。相比其他编程语言,Golang的标准库给开发者提供了更多的选择和支持。这意味着在使用Golang进行开发时,我们可以更专注于业务逻辑的实现,而不需要从头开始构建基础模块。
最后,Golang以其卓越的性能而著称。Golang通过运行时系统(Runtime System)的提供的垃圾回收机制,有效地管理内存资源,减少了内存泄漏的风险。此外,Golang还通过编译为机器码执行,减少了解释的开销,使得程序的运行速度更快。这让Golang成为大规模分布式系统、网络服务和高性能应用程序开发的首选语言。无论是对于个人项目还是企业级应用,Golang都能够提供出色的性能表现。
综上所述,作为一个专业的Golang开发者,我坚信Golang是值得投资的。其出色的并发处理能力、丰富的标准库以及卓越的性能使得Golang成为开发高质量、高效率应用的理想选择。因此,如果你正考虑投资于编程语言,不妨选择Golang,相信它能够带来不错的回报。